
今天刷到TIOBE 12月的编程语言排行榜心里有点小震惊。平时看新闻Java不是一直挺稳的吗结果这回直接掉到第四了。前几个月还在前三晃荡现在连C都比不过了。Python还是老样子第一坐得稳稳的。23.64%的市场份额比第二名高出一倍都不止。虽然比上个月少了0.21%但这点波动根本不影响地位。感觉现在学编程的人十个有八个是从Python开始的。最猛的是C语言直接从第四干到第二。市场份额涨了1.01%到了10.11%。说实话我都以为C要慢慢凉了毕竟语法老派写起来麻烦。结果人家在嵌入式、操作系统这些地方还是没人能替。C就有点尴尬了从第二滑到第三。份额掉到8.95%一下被C拉开差距。现在新项目很少有人主动选C了除非真有极致性能要求。学过就知道指针和内存管理能把人搞崩溃新手基本劝退。Java这次跌得真不轻。8.7%的份额下降1.02%是前十里掉得比较多的。不过也正常国内大厂像阿里腾讯虽然还在用但新团队越来越多用Go或者Spring Boot这类更轻的东西。而且安卓开发也不全靠Java了Kotlin慢慢上位。C倒是争气涨了2.39%排第五。微软这几年发力真狠.NET生态越做越好Unity游戏开发也靠它撑着。看得出来企业级应用这块还是挺吃得开。第六和第七名有意思JavaScript和Visual Basic市场份额都是2.96%但一个跌一个涨。JS用了这么多年框架换了一轮又一轮大家有点疲了。VB看起来过时但在老系统维护和一些企业内部工具里还活着。SQL排第八涨了点。这玩意儿怎么说呢不管什么架构都得用数据库查询刚需。Perl和R都杀回前十了特别是R搞数据分析的基本都得会点统计建模离不了。Fortran还在虽然份额掉了点。这语言几十年了科学计算、气象模拟这些领域还有人在用。MATLAB涨了一些工科学生估计都熟写算法方便。Go语言这次掉得有点多跌到第十五降了0.8%。之前说是云原生时代的宠儿结果Rust和其他语言分走不少风头。PHP也在掉但没到凉透的地步毕竟还有不少老网站在跑。Rust涨得慢就多了0.01%。这语言公认好内存安全又高效但上手难推广起来吃力。Kotlin勉强守住第二十安卓开发转它是个趋势只是还没完全普及。Assembly排第十九也就0.01%的变动。这种底层语言除了做驱动或者逆向工程一般人根本碰不到。Scratch倒是跌了不少可能是因为少儿编程热度过了Ada排第十四涨得挺猛。这语言用在航空航天、军工这些高安全领域要求太高普通人接触不到。Delphi现在也就一些老项目在维护还能排到十一也算顽强。整体看下来老语言并没全死但位置在变。Python通吃AI、数据、Web确实强得离谱。C语言靠着底层需求活得好好的。Java虽然跌但底子厚一时半会儿倒不了。C、R、Perl这种特定领域的语言反而有回暖迹象。可能是某些行业项目多了或者教学里重新重视起来。反倒是Go、PHP这些曾经热门的增长乏力。看得出来技术圈变天了。不再是几个大语言垄断一切而是各找各的生态位。你搞AI就用Python做嵌入式可能就得上C搞游戏后端也许是C各有各的活法。